About this role

Machine Learning Engineer Overview Models are surprisingly bad at reasoning about themselves: training dynamics, evaluation design, data pipelines, and deployment trade-offs. Plausible-sounding ML advice is often subtly wrong. As a Machine Learning Engineer you'll stress-test how models reason about ML systems and write the answers a strong practitioner would give, shaping how the next generation handles your field. What you’ll actually do Write prompts that probe how models reason about training, evaluation, debugging, and productionizing ML systems. Review AI output for subtle errors: leaky evaluations, wrong loss formulations, and misdiagnosed training failures. Write the correct solution when the model falls short, grounded in real practitioner experience. What we look for Hands-on experience training, evaluating, or deploying models professionally or in serious personal work. Comfort with the modern ML stack; most tasks assume Python and PyTorch or JAX. Clear written English: your explanations are the training signal. No degree required.
